Five 13th Region Soccer Players Earn East All-State Honors

LEXINGTON — The Kentucky High School Soccer Coaches Association has released its East All-State Teams, and four local boys’ players along with one standout girls’ player received recognition for their performances this season.

Boys’ Soccer

Oneida Baptist’s Hero Khajohnsupawatchara and North Laurel’s Jaxon Jacobs were both selected to the First Team East All-State, highlighting their impact as two of the region’s most consistent and dynamic playmakers.

Khajohnsupawatchara finished with 30 goals and 12 assists while helping the Mountaineers to the 49th and 13th Region titles.

Jacobs scored 23 goals and finished with 12 assists for the Jaguars.

On the Second Team, Oneida Baptist was represented by Amadeus Martin, while North Laurel’s Jaron Edwards also earned a spot. Both players were key contributors throughout the season and helped anchor their respective programs.

Martin totaled 17 goals and 17 assists for the Mountaineers while Edwards turned in a stellar season at the keeper position for the Jaguars. He finished with 181 saves and allowed only 52 goals. 

Girls’ Soccer

North Laurel standout Haley Combs received Honorable Mention on the East All-State list following a standout season in which she emerged as one of the region’s most dangerous scorers and playmakers.

Combs tallied 21 goals while dishing out two assists. She helped guide the Lady Jaguars to the 49th and 13th Region titles.
